What is a Contractual Agreement?

A Contractual Agreement forms the backbone of business dealings in Saudi Arabia, creating legally binding obligations between two or more parties. It spells out what each side promises to do, setting clear terms about services, payments, timelines, and responsibilities under Sharia law principles and the Kingdom's commercial regulations.

In Saudi business practice, these agreements must be written in both Arabic and English to be fully enforceable, with the Arabic version taking precedence. They typically include key elements like offer and acceptance, consideration (monetary or otherwise), and the genuine intent of all parties to be bound by the terms - all while staying within the bounds of Islamic commercial principles and Saudi public policy.

When should you use a Contractual Agreement?

Use a Contractual Agreement anytime you engage in significant business transactions in Saudi Arabia, especially when dealing with services, property, or long-term partnerships. This formal document becomes essential when starting new vendor relationships, hiring contractors, leasing commercial space, or establishing distribution channels within the Kingdom.

The agreement proves particularly valuable for complex transactions requiring Sharia compliance, or when dealing with government entities and large corporations. It creates a clear record of obligations, protecting both parties from misunderstandings and providing a solid foundation if disputes arise. For international business dealings, having both Arabic and English versions helps ensure smooth cross-border operations while meeting local legal requirements.

What are the different types of Contractual Agreement?

  • Service Contractual Agreements: Common in consulting and professional services, detailing scope, deliverables, and payment terms under Saudi commercial law
  • Employment Contractual Agreements: Outlining worker rights and obligations according to Saudi Labor Law standards
  • Real Estate Contractual Agreements: Used for property sales and leases, incorporating Sharia-compliant financing terms
  • Distribution Contractual Agreements: Governing supplier-distributor relationships in compliance with Saudi commercial agency regulations
  • Government Contractual Agreements: Special formats following public procurement rules and additional compliance requirements for state entities

What should be included in a Contractual Agreement?

  • Party Details: Full legal names, addresses, and registration numbers of all parties, with proper Arabic transliteration
  • Agreement Purpose: Clear statement of objectives and scope, ensuring Sharia compliance and commercial validity
  • Consideration Terms: Detailed payment schedules, pricing, and financial obligations that align with Islamic finance principles
  • Duration Clauses: Specific start dates, termination conditions, and renewal options under Saudi commercial law
  • Dispute Resolution: Clear procedures for conflict resolution, specifying Saudi courts' jurisdiction and applicable laws
  • Signature Block: Proper format for authorized signatories, including official stamps and attestation requirements

What's the difference between a Contractual Agreement and an Agency Agreement?

A Contractual Agreement differs significantly from an Agency Agreement in Saudi Arabia, though both are essential business documents. While a Contractual Agreement establishes general binding obligations between parties, an Agency Agreement specifically governs the relationship between a principal and their appointed agent, following strict regulations under Saudi Commercial Agencies Law.

  • Scope and Purpose: Contractual Agreements cover a broad range of business transactions, while Agency Agreements focus solely on authorizing one party to act on behalf of another
  • Legal Requirements: Agency Agreements must be registered with the Ministry of Commerce and require specific documentation for commercial agent registration
  • Duration and Termination: Agency Agreements often have special protections for Saudi agents and specific compensation requirements upon termination, unlike standard Contractual Agreements
  • Territory Rights: Agency Agreements typically include exclusive territorial rights within Saudi Arabia, which isn't a standard feature in general Contractual Agreements
